What is livechat?
LiveChat is a customer service software that enables businesses to communicate with their customers in real-time through chat. Its primary purpose is to facilitate instant support and improve customer engagement on websites.
What is chatwoot?
Chatwoot is an open-source customer engagement platform that allows businesses to manage conversations across multiple channels. Its primary purpose is to provide a unified platform for customer support and engagement.
Key Differences
- Pricing Model: LiveChat operates on a subscription-based model, while Chatwoot is open-source and can be self-hosted.
- Deployment Options: LiveChat is primarily cloud-based, whereas Chatwoot offers both self-hosted and cloud options.
- Support Structure: LiveChat provides 24/7 customer support, while Chatwoot relies on community support.
- User Interface: LiveChat features a customizable user interface, while Chatwoot has a simpler, more straightforward design.
- Analytics Features: LiveChat includes built-in analytics tools, whereas Chatwoot offers basic analytics capabilities.
Which Should You Choose?
Choose livechat if you need a fully managed service with 24/7 support and advanced analytics features. It is suitable for businesses that prefer a customizable interface and require extensive integration options.
Choose chatwoot if you are looking for a cost-effective solution and have the technical resources to self-host. It is ideal for small to medium businesses that want to manage customer interactions across multiple channels without ongoing subscription fees.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is livechat suitable for small businesses?
Yes, livechat can be used by small businesses, but its pricing may be more suitable for larger organizations due to subscription costs.
Can chatwoot be used for free?
Yes, chatwoot is open-source, which means it can be used for free if self-hosted, though there may be costs associated with hosting and maintenance.
What types of integrations does livechat offer?
LiveChat offers integrations with various platforms, including CRM systems, email marketing tools, and e-commerce platforms.
Is chatwoot easy to set up?
Chatwoot can be set up relatively easily, but the self-hosted option may require technical knowledge for installation and configuration.
